    Looks like there is something going on with the harness or not everything is plugged in or properly grounded.

    Using a noid light on a direct injection injector isn't the best way to diagnose injector circuits as the boost voltage is around 65V and noid lights were never meant to operate much over 12V. You should be using a oscilloscope with an amp clamp of the correct range to get a good signal.

    That being said, we need a log of you actually cranking the engine over.

    I think 5FDP is on to something with the clear flood mode, commanded EQ ratio is .190.
